Compare all specifications:

2009 Jaguar XJ 2005 Porsche 996
Make Jaguar Porsche
Model XJ 996
Year Released 2009 2005
Body Type Sedan Convertible
Engine Position Front Rear
Engine Size 2966 cc 3594 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type V in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 235 HP 317 HP
Engine RPM 6800 RPM 6800 RPM
Torque 293 Nm 370 Nm
Torque RPM 4100 RPM 4250 RPM
Engine Bore Size 89 mm 96 mm
Engine Stroke Size 79.5 mm 82.8 mm
Fuel Type Gasoline - Premium Gasoline
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Transmission Type Automatic Manual
Number of Seats 5 seats 4 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 1614 kg 1520 kg
Vehicle Length 5100 mm 4440 mm
Vehicle Width 1870 mm 1840 mm
Vehicle Height 1450 mm 1310 mm
Wheelbase Size 3040 mm 2360 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 85 L 64 L
